Rebecca Budig exits as Greenlee, & admits to having struggled w/ her character this go round:"I felt like the character was of lost; at least I couldn't really find her legs again"...it was when Greenlee shared scenes w/ Erica that RB felt connected to her character.

Editorial praising JR Martinez as Brot...

Bobbie Eakes (Krystal) is performer of the week!

Annie has a breakthrough...David has Amanda under his thumb & Amanda is desperate to be free of David...Annie spies on Greens..."Reese can't deny her feelings for Zach"...

Binx & Reese fight due to the stress of guilt about Kendall, & Bianca says some regrettable things to Reese, who later forgives her. Kendall's condition for attending the wedding is that Bianca & Reese return to Paris immediately afterwards, & they agree. At the wedding rehearsal, the site of Zach carrying Gabrielle angers Kendall, who delivers a venomous toast that cuts down Reese, insinuates that there's something going on between Zach & Reese, & that has ramifications. Bianca & Reese fight, & Reese goes off to get drunk. Zach goes after Reese to check on her, & they share a "way too friendly kiss", which they know was wrong, & that was witnessed by Ryan. Ryan tells Greens, adding that he thinks that Zach & Reese definitely had sex, & says that he doesn't want to be part of a double wedding w/ Bianca/Reese because they're marrying on a lie & Ryan won't be a part of that. Greenlee doubts that Zach would cheat on Kendall, & gets on her motorcycle to see him.

Ryan phones & lies that Greens has food poisoning & that they won't be getting married. Kendall learns that Bianca will remain in PV & storms off. The Reese/Bianca wedding takes place, minus the Slaters. Kendall, who is arguing w/ Zach, is driving on the wrong side of the road, hitting Greens & sending her over a cliff to a watery grave.

    • At this point, Marlena, John, and Roman all thought Roman was Belle's father. Sami had switched the initial blood tests. When it was time for another round of tests (because Belle was jaundiced), Sami panicked and kidnapped the baby.  Up until January 1994, Sami was the only one who knew that John was Belle's father. Next up were Stefano and Peter, once Stefano read Sami's diary (he figured it would reveal what was going on between John & Marlena). Stefano revealed the truth of Belle's parentage to Roman AFTER Marlena revealed her tryst with John (about two weeks later, to be exact). Marlena and John were the last ones to find out (during February sweeps, naturally). The John Black name was revived in September 1991.
